A couple recent threads have me thinking about how spin is achieved for various movement pitches. I've struggled getting gadgets like the spinner or a roll of tape to work for me, so I've been hesitant to use it over a striped ball. For me, I can't get the same feel without adding my thumb to making the ball spin.

What are your cues/feels/grips/methods to get and teach spin?

I agree with Bill, I'm not saying that whip doesn't have a huge impact on the ball, I was just trying to understand the desire to not use the thumb at all. IMHO if one side of the hand is turning, so should the other side. Your thumb doesn't move very fast on it's own, but if you use a bit of pressure against the ball and the opposing fingers, you can get quite a bit of speed (spinning a top).
